My family (2 daughters, 15 & 18) have traveled to Maui, San Francisco, NYC, Washington DC, Miami, two cruises to East & West Caribbean, Atlantis on Paradise Island. Where can we go this summer that will be a good memory for them, includes beaches, and lots of things to do and see? Can be outside the US. We've run out of fun places! Girls not interested in London or Paris. HELP!

Consider bucking the 'beach' thing and do Grand Canyon, Sedona, etc...my girls are 17 and 19 and did not want to do this trip I had planned for last July. Well it turned out to be our best family vacation ever! They got some down time when we stayed a few days in Vegas before flying home.

Australia. The area around Cairns (pronounced "cans") in northeastern Australia has the Great Barrier Reef, tropical rainforests, awesome, uninhabited beaches, mountains and so much more. It's not that expensive to go there, everybody speaks english and the exchange rate is in our favor.
